Democratic governor in Del. supports gay marriage
Mar 2, 2012, 10:25 PM
DOVER, Del. (AP) – Democratic Gov. Jack Markell says he supports legalizing gay marriage in Delaware.
Markell’s spokeswoman Cathy Rossi said Friday that he supports gay marriage, although he believes the state should focus on implementing a same-sex civil union law that took effect in January.
Opponents of the civil union legislation in Delaware argued last year that it was a prelude to establishing same-sex marriage, But there are no current proposals in the legislature to do so.
Maryland’s governor signed a bill Thursday legalizing gay marriage in that state.
